==Preserves Jar vs. Keg==

The Preserves Jar increases the profit of a crop using the following equation: (2 × Base [[Crops|Crop]] Value + 50); while the [[Keg]] multiplies the base value of [[Fruits]] by 3, and [[Vegetables]] by 2.25. Because of this, low-value, high-yield crops like [[Corn]] or [[tomato|Tomatoes]] are more valuable in the preserves jar. The keg, on the other hand, favors crops with a much higher base value, such as [[Ancient Fruit]] or [[Melon]]s. Below is a list of crops that are more beneficial to be put in the preserves jar.

It should be noted that these calculations ONLY involve the value gained in terms of max profit; if looking at profit per day based on the time required (2 days for the preserves jar, 7 days for the keg, plus aging time if desired), it is ALWAYS more beneficial to use a preserves jar, on the highest value item possible. Even starred crops do not approach the same amount of profit per day in a keg as in the preserves jar.
